The reason why dogs cannot be buried in the soil after death is to prevent unnecessary effects. If the dog died of some infectious disease, it is best not to bury it in the soil, because this may cause the spread of these viruses. We Cremation is preferred. Dogs that die normally can be buried in the soil, but we need to choose a sparsely populated place away from water sources.

Tip:

You must be careful when disposing of a dog’s body. We should not throw the dead dog’s body in the trash can, let alone leave its body in broad daylight. It is recommended that all bodies be cremated.
